Edited by FearAgent89: 7/5/2015 12:00:01 AMDefinitely not in PvP. We need to be able to see the helmets. If you see a Titan standing in a bubble with a Saint 14 helmet, you can expect to get blinded when you go in there. If I'm running toward a Warlock, about to hit a Shoulder Thrust, and I see he's wearing a Ram helmet, I know I'm better off stopping and shooting him with a shotgun.
